About The Position

Boeing Defense Space and Security (BDS) is hiring for a Senior Design and Analysis Engineer (Electronic Sys Design & Analy) at our office located in Berkeley, MO. BDS is a global leader in the development, production, maintenance and enhancement of fixed-wing and rotary wing aircraft, commercial and government satellites, human spaceflight programs and weapons. The Senior Design and Analysis Engineer will be responsible for leading weapon-to-platform integration. You will own integration architecture, verification strategy, and technical delivery; lead cross-functional integration activities spanning avionics, software, structures, and flight test; mentor engineers; and act as the technical point-of-contact for program stakeholders, suppliers, and certification authorities. This role requires robust systems engineering rigor and strong judgment on risk and tradeoffs.

Responsibilities

  • Own integration architecture and system-level interface control strategy (ICDs, buses, power, mechanical, data links) from concept through flight test and into production sustainment
  • Define and own verification & validation strategy (IV&V) for the program: traceability from requirements to test evidence and certification artifacts
  • Collaborate and coordinate with additional Test focused teams to ensure timely delivery of capabilities
  • Lead development and approval of integration and verification plans, acceptance criteria, test procedures, and data products required by Certification/Safety
  • Execute program plans and priorities using JIRA and MBSE tools
  • Serve as technical lead across cross-functional teams (avionics, software, test, manufacturing, suppliers); resolve escalation items and drive corrective action for integration anomalies
  • Provide mentorship and technical leadership to mid/junior engineers; champion systems engineering best practices (MBSE, formal requirements traceability)
  • Act as the primary technical interface to suppliers; assess supplier integration approaches, conduct technical reviews, and lead root-cause/resolution for supplier-delivered anomalies
  • Drive risk management: identify integration risks, communicate to program leadership, and lead mitigation planning and trade studies
  • Coordinate with Certification/Safety and Security organizations; prepare and present technical briefings and program deliverables.
  • Contribute to organizational continuous improvement: capture lessons learned, tooling enhancements (e.g., DAQ, flight test instrumentation), and process improvements
